Mia’s Reviews > Dead Aid: Why Aid Is Not Working and How There Is a Better Way for Africa > Status Update

Mia
Mia is on page 150 of 208
Feb 19, 2022 01:41PM
Dead Aid: Why Aid Is Not Working and How There Is a Better Way for Africa

flag

No comments have been added yet.